Penn-griffin Schools has 599 learners in grade levels 6-12.

Penn-griffin Schools placed in the lower 50% of all schools in North Carolina for cumulative test scores (math proficiency is lower 50%, and reading proficiency is upper 50%) for the 2020-21 school year.

The percentage of learners achieving proficiency in math is 32% (which is lower than the North Carolina state average of 48%) for the 2020-21 school year. The percentage of learners ach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 46% (which is lower than the North Carolina state average of 47%) for the 2020-21 school year.

The learner:teacher ratio of 14:1 is lower than the North Carolina state average of 16:1.

Minority enrollment is 74% of the learner body (majority African-American), which is higher than the North Carolina state average of 52% (majority African-American and Latino).

School Overview: Penn-griffin Schools’s learner population of 599 learners has decreased by 6% over five school years.

The teacher population of 43 teachers has decreased by 10% over five school years.

School Comparison: Penn-griffin Schools is ranked within the lower 50% of all 2,561 schools in North Carolina (based off of cumulative math and reading proficiency testing data) for the 2020-21 school year.

The equity score of Penn-griffin Schools is 0.69, which is more than the equity score at state average of 0.68. The school’s equity has stayed flat over five school years.
